Veritas Education are currently recruiting for a dedicated and nurturing Intervention Teacher on behalf of a welcoming primary school in Pendle. The school are looking for an intervention teacher to work across Key Stage 2 focusing interventions with small groups of students working across all of key stage 2. This is an exciting opportunity for a teacher passionate about supporting pupils with additional learning needs and helping children reach their full potential through targeted intervention support.

The school is continuing to develop and expand its SEN and intervention provision, investing in additional support strategies and tailored learning approaches to ensure all pupils receive the support they need to succeed. The leadership team are committed to inclusion, staff wellbeing and providing a positive learning environment for both pupils and staff.

The successful candidate will:

  • Have experience supporting pupils with SEND and additional learning needs
  • Deliver targeted intervention sessions across primary age ranges
  • Adapt learning to meet individual pupil needs
  • Work closely with class teachers, SENCOs and support staff
  • Build positive relationships with pupils, parents and colleagues
  • Demonstrate patience, flexibility and strong behaviour management skills

The school offers:

  • A supportive and experienced senior leadership team
  • A welcoming and inclusive school environment
  • Opportunities for continued CPD and SEN training
  • Strong teamwork and collaborative staff culture
  • Well‑resourced intervention and learning spaces

The school is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children. All applicants will be subject to:

  • Enhanced DBS and barred list checks
  • Qualified Teacher Status verification
  • Right to work and identity checks
  • Online checks in line with Keeping Children Safe in Education guidance
  • Reference and employment history checks
  • Prohibition from teaching checks
  • Safer recruitment and pre‑employment vetting checks

Any gaps in employment history will be discussed at interview.
